Album US 1968 on Prestige label
Jazz, Rock, Latin and R&B/Soul (Latin Jazz, Soul-Jazz, Psychedelic, Jazz-Rock)
Some of the detailed credits culled from liner notes. This album was recorded on three separate days during December at Impact Sound Studios on West 65th Street. "Left In The Cold", "No One Knows" and "Big Stick" were given their finishing touches with addition of a four voice male chorus consisting of Jackie Soul, Bivens, Cecil Jackson, an unidentified friend and a bottle of Ballantine (the more potent kind).
